Twitter is a social media platform and microblog. These microblogs are known as ‘tweets.’ By subscribing (following) to other users, you can keep up with their tweets. Any time they post a new tweet, it will automatically appear in your timeline. You can ‘like,’ ‘reply to,’ or ‘share’ (retweet) tweets you find interesting. This way, your followers will know what interests you. You can also send your tweets to share your thoughts with the world. Each tweet contains a maximum of 280 characters. You can include links, images, and videos in your tweet.

Tipsters use Twitter to share their knowledge about betting, upcoming games, and special offers with bookmakers. A lot of tipsters use a ‘public’ and a ‘private’ account. The public accounts are free and open to anyone. The private ones are premium accounts and accessible by invitation only.


Who is on Twitter, and where are they located

Twitter is popular in Western counties such as the USA and UK. But it is also prevalent in Asian countries such as Japan and South Korea. Most Twitter users are relatively young: approximately 31% are between 18-24 years old, and 27.3% are between 25-34. In the third quarter of 2019, Twitter had 145 million daily Twitter users.

Celebrities and politicians use Twitter to share updates with their followers. A lot of official organizations also use Twitter to send important updates about emergencies. For instance, earthquakes, COVID-19, bushfires, and such.

The ability to share news also makes it an ideal communication channel for activists. Twitter has played a vital role in raising awareness for School Strike for Climate, MeToo, BlackLivesMatter, and LBGTQ+ awareness.

Because of this, Twitter has become an essential source of information. A lot of Twitter users only use their accounts to keep up with trending topics. Research published in April 2014 showed that roughly 44% of all Twitter users had never tweeted.

How safe is it to use Twitter for your betting game

It is relatively safe to use Twitter. As with most popular social platforms, it cannot afford not to be safe. But the platform does have its weaknesses. It isn’t easy to check if users are who they say they are. For instance, in 2009, The company was sued by the American rapper Kanye West because someone was impersonating him. According to him, Twitter failed to address the issue.

Since then, Twitter has implemented a verified status option for ‘people of public interest.’ People of public interest are actors, politicians, musicians, official organizations, business leaders. A blue checkmark next to their profile picture shows that Twitter has verified the identity of this user. It is not available for ordinary users. How Safe is Twitter

Twitter has been the victim of security breaches in the past. Over the years, hackers hacked high profile and other accounts. Including that of Jack Dorsey, the company CEO. To prevent this from happening again, they are continuously investing to keep its platform safe.

security for Twitter

Security

There are things you can do to keep your account safe:

  • Select a strong and exclusive password
  • Use login verification
  • Also, use email and phone number to request a reset password link or code
  • Always keep an eye out for suspicious links and, before entering your login information, always make sure you are on the real website
  • Never give your username and password to third parties.
  • Make sure your computer, smartphone, and browser use up-to-date software

How Does Twitter Make Money

Twitter makes money from advertising. They have a stock exchange listing. Twitter is free to use, but they use the information generated by their users to make money. Yes, that includes you too. For instance, they use (and sell) that information to customize ads. These include their own ads and ads from third parties.

Tipsters can make money using Twitter by charging a subscription fee for their private accounts. To gain access to such an account, you will have to pay first. Tipsters also use free and public Twitter accounts that anyone can follow. Tipsters often also have their online platforms to which you need to subscribe. They use public Twitter accounts to show potential members that they know what they are talking about. By giving away free tips, they hope to convince you to subscribe to their platform.

History of Twitter

On 26 March 2006, Jack Dorsey posted the first tweet: ‘Just setting up my twttr.’ The idea of an SMS-based social platform came to life during a daylong brainstorm session at Odeo. Odeo was an American podcast company, and it used Twitter as an in-house service. On 15 July 2006, the service went public. In October 2007, it became an independent company.

At first, they named the service ‘twttr’ because the domain’ twitter’ was claimed already. 6 months after the launch, they could buy the domain and renamed it: Twitter. They chose this name because, according to Jack Dorsey: ‘…we came across the word ‘twitter’, and it was just perfect. The definition was ‘a short burst of inconsequential information,’ and ‘chirps from birds’. And that definition is precisely what product was.…’

The companies strategy is to buy other tech companies to help Twitter grow. For instance: Vine, Crashlytics, Niche, Nano Media, and Periscope. They use their expertise to help expand Twitter’s activities. Some of these allowed them to add images to the tweets, including videos, links, etc. Some helped them improve their security measures and remove malware. Others helped them to generate more income from advertising.

For a long time, the maximum length of a tweet was 140 characters. In 2017, the maximum amount changed to 280 characters per tweet.
